Welfare Overhaul Work Programme Update: key priorities and next steps.

21 March 2023.

This Cabinet paper provides an update on the progress of the welfare overhaul work programme, including the impact of the programme since 2017 and achievements of the work. It also outlines key priorities for the next phase of the work.
